WILMINGTON, N.C. (WECT) - The Cape Fear Volunteer Center is in need of 20 people to make 20 turkeys or turkey breasts to be distributed on Thanksgiving to people in need. They would need to be fully cooked, transported at room temperature, to Myrtle Grove Evangelical Presbyterian Church at 5 p.m. on Wednesday, November 26, 2020.

“This year we have a special need of more turkeys because there’s more people in need,” said Annie Anthony, CEO of the Cape Fear Volunteer Center. “But also last year, a very special part of the turkey making team was killed in a car accident and their family had done 10 turkeys each year. So due to the loss of family members and income more turkeys are needed.”
